Galen is a dancer, choreographer and director with over 30 years of experience in the entertainment industry.

She has worked with over 70 artists as a dancer and choreographer, from Janet Jackson to Justin Bieber, Coldplay to Camila Cabello. Other credits include La La Land, Camp Rock, Dancing with the Stars, The Oscars, The Superbowl, and the upcoming film “A Big Bold Beautiful Journey” starring Colin Farrell and Margot Robbie.

THE SCIENCE

  • The Benefits of Dance

    Dance is a holistic exercise with data-backed benefits:

    Physical: Dance improves cardiovascular health, muscular strength, endurance, coordination, balance, flexibility, agility and strengthens bones as a weight bearing exercise.

    Mental: Learning and recalling choreography challenges your brain by improving memory, focus, and cognitive function. This constant mental workout has been linked to a reduced risk of cognitive decline as you get older.

    Emotional: Reduces Stress & Anxiety. Moving to music naturally releases endorphins, the body's feel-good chemicals. Dance serves as a powerful outlet for emotional expression, helping to release tension, boost your mood, and combat symptoms of stress and depression.

  • Weight Training

    Lifting weights significantly enhances bone density, helping to prevent osteoporosis by stimulating bone-forming cells.

    By increasing muscle mass, weightlifting also boosts your metabolism, improves functional strength (making everyday tasks easier), and enhances joint stability, reducing the risk of injury.

    Plus, the accomplishment of lifting weights has a profound impact on mental well-being by boosting self-esteem!

  • Stretching

    “I really need to stretch”.

    Regular stretching improves flexibility and range of motion, allowing your joints to move through their full potential and preventing stiffness that can hinder everyday activities.

    Post-workout stretching, in particular, can help reduce muscle soreness by promoting blood flow and flushing out metabolic waste products.

    Beyond the physical, stretching can also have a calming effect on the mind, helping to reduce stress and release tension held in the muscles.

    You’re not just lengthening your muscles, but also enhancing your body's ability to move freely and efficiently.
